The Dance of Nature

Leaves are not mere remnants of a tree's biological functions; they are intricately woven threads of nature's intricate tapestry. As autumn arrives, the leaves undergo a spectacular transformation, donning shades of gold, red, and orange. This kaleidoscope of colors signals the approaching winter, inviting us to witness the mesmerizing ballet of falling leaves.

The process of leaf fall, scientifically known as abscission, is a fascinating mechanism perfected by nature over millions of years. It begins with a signaling process triggered by the changes in temperature, daylight duration, and hormone levels within the tree. These signals prompt the cells to build a protective layer, known as the abscission zone, which weakens the union between the leaf and the tree.

As the abscission zone becomes more pronounced, the leaf's nutrient supply is gradually cut off, causing it to wither and lose its green pigmentation. This change renders the leaf less functional for photosynthesis, eventually leading to its detachment. And so, like a graceful dancer parting from its partner, the leaf falls in a poetic descent.
